Robert P. Bresnahan, Jr. sold Paychex Inc (NASDAQ: PAYX)

Robert P. Bresnahan, Jr. (R-PA), a U.S. Representative, has disclosed 1 trade in Paychex Inc (PAYX) since 2025, a single sale, worth an estimated $8K in disclosed volume (the midpoint of the dollar ranges members report, not exact amounts).

The trade highlighted here is a sale: Robert P. Bresnahan, Jr. sold $1,001 - $15,000 of Paychex Inc (NASDAQ: PAYX) on January 13, 2025. Since that trade, PAYX is down -8.27% against the S&P 500 up +27.29%, an outperformance of -35.56%.

Is it legal for Robert P. Bresnahan, Jr. to trade Paychex Inc (PAYX) stock?

Yes. Members of Congress are allowed to trade individual stocks, including Paychex Inc (PAYX), but the STOCK Act of 2012 requires them to publicly disclose each transaction within 45 days. Quantellect tracks those disclosures; this page does not imply the trade was improper.

How soon must members of Congress disclose a trade?

Under the STOCK Act, members of Congress must publicly report a covered transaction within 45 days of the trade. Filings can still be delayed, amended, or contain errors.
